Transaction or account settings submitted in the transaction request string will always override settings in the Authorize.net Merchant Interface. Most merchants rarely modify Merchant Interface settings that could impact their integration. However, changes to settings in the Merchant Interface could affect values in the transaction response, or the way information is returned in the transaction response. This could lead to unexpected behavior with the transaction response, or issues with parsing the transaction response correctly.

To avoid this, it is recommended to set fields in the transaction request string that format the transaction response on a per-transaction basis. Examples of such fields are x_test_request, x_delim_data, x_delim_char, x_encap_char, x_relay_response, x_duplicate_window, and x_response_format.
